On its first release in 1975, 'Views' went straight to number one in the Sunday Times bestseller list and went on to sell more than one million copies. This new edition, reworked to accompany 2008's 'Dragon's Dream', showcases the instantly recognizable work of Roger Dean.
A beautiful new edition of the bestselling classic by acclaimed artist Roger Dean! Views showcases the first seven years of Roger Dean's work after his graduation from the Royal College of Art in 1968. It includes paintings and graphics, groundbreaking stage sets, and album art including iconic early YES covers such as the award-winning Tales From Topographic Oceans. Featuring a new foreword, revised typography, and graphic openers and identifying icons, Views showcases and celebrates the art that defined an era.
